JOB DESCRIPTION AND POSITION REQUIREMENTS:

We are searching for a qualified Security Specialist to join our Security Services Office at the Applied Research Laboratory (ARL) at Penn State University.  ARL’s purpose is to research and develop innovative solutions to challenging scientific, engineering, and technology problems in support of the Navy, the Department of Defense (DoD), and the Intel Community (IC). 

You will:

  • Assist with the development of industrial security practices, procedures, processes trainings, and briefings, while ensuring compliance with government policies and regulations

  • Provide agile and efficient security support and customer service to all organizational groups and personnel in an extremely fast-paced, complex and rapidly evolving environment

  • Work autonomously in a very busy and highly service-driven environment

  • Prepare for and represent ARL in all aspects of security inspections and oversight by U.S. government (USG) agencies

This position will be filled as a level 2 or level 3, depending upon the successful candidate’s education and experience. Typically requires an Associate’s degree, or an equivalent combination of education and experience for the level 2. Additional experience and/or education and competencies are required for higher level jobs.

Required skills/experience areas include:

  • Demonstrated success handling classified materials

  • Microsoft Office software, databases, and web applications

  • Past success as a service-oriented team-player, with polished interpersonal and office skills

  • Success in an office environment, where various forms of communication and organizational skills were crucial to be effective

  • Demonstrated  ability to work autonomously and effectively in fast-paced environment

Preferred skills/experience areas include:

  • A Bachelor’s or advanced degree in Security, Risk Management/Analysis, Criminal Justice, Military Science, or Business Administration

  • Security Information Management System (SIMS)

  • Department of Defense (DoD) security systems such as DISS or NBIS

  • Government security clearance process and requirements

  • DoD or USG-based industrial security experience; as well as

  • Cyber and physical security principles, including sensitive and/or controlled information, electronic access controls, alarm systems, and video surveillance
